SAFED (Safe And Fuel Efficient Driving)

Monitoring and managing the fuel used by their vehicles is vital for a professional operator. By implementing a fuel management programme, a fleet’s fuel consumption can typically be reduced by at least 5%, with an equivalent cost saving.
Use of safe and fuel-efficient driving techniques as part of a fuel management process will contribute to this fuel saving.
Reducing fuel consumption by 1,000 litres per year will:
Save an operator £900 a year (assuming a price of 90 pence per litre, excluding VAT)
Save 2.6 tonnes of carbon dioxide emissions a year
Using fuel more efficiently means:
- Lower costs
- Improved profit margins
- Reduced emissions
- Improved environmental performance
Safer driving means:
- Less injuries and fatalities on our roads
- Less accident damage to vehicles
- Less unproductive downtime for vehicle repair
- Reduced insurance premiums
